Ingredients:

  • 1 cup quinoa – provides a nutty flavor and a complete protein source.
  • 1 can chickpeas – adds a hearty texture and protein boost.
  • 1 onion – adds a savory sweetness to the dish.
  • 2 cloves garlic – provides a pungent flavor base.
  • 1 bell pepper – adds a pop of color and crunch.
  • 1 tablespoon curry powder – adds a warm and aromatic spice blend.
  • 1 teaspoon cumin – adds a smoky and earthy flavor.
  • 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per – adds a spicy kick.
  • Salt and pepper to taste – enhances the overall flavor profile.

Preparing the Ingredients

Before you start cooking, make sure to rinse the quinoa thoroughly to remove any bitterness. Drain and rinse the chickpeas as well to remove excess sodium. Chop the onion, garlic, and bell pepper into bite-sized pieces for easy stir-frying.

Temperature and Timing Guide

Heat your skillet or wok over medium-high heat before adding the ingredients. Stir-fry the vegetables and spices for about 5-7 minutes until they are tender and fragrant. Add the quinoa and chickpeas and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es to heat through. Season with salt and pepper to taste before serving.

Common Issues and Solutions

  • If your stir-fry is too dry, add a splash of vegetable broth or water to create a sauce.
  • If your stir-fry is too salty, balance it out with a squeeze of fresh lemon juice or a sprinkle of sugar.
  • If your stir-fry is too spicy, add a dollop of yogurt or coconut milk to mellow out the heat.

Instructions:

  1. Heat a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at.
  2. Add a drizzle of oil and sauté the onion and garlic until fragrant.
  3. Add the bell pepper, curry powder, cumin, and cayenne pepper.
  4. Stir-fry for 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are tender.
  5. Add the quinoa and chickpeas, stirring to combine.
  6.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es until heated through.
  7.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  8. Serve hot and enjoy!
